Web3 mrt. 2024 · Be not deceived; God is not mocked: for whatsoever a man soweth, that shall he also reap Galatians 6:7. This message of Paul reminds us that whatever we do (sow) has consequences (reap). Many people believe that they can do anything and get away with it. But he sidestepped one very timely matter — the six-week abortion ban he signed into law not 12 hours earlier. “Last night, after the legislature there passed the bill, he signed the ... have it all halWeb19 mei 2009 · In the Bible, the feeling of shame is normally caused by public exposure of one’s guilt (Genesis 2:25; 3:10). Shame may also be caused by a hurt reputation or embarrassment, whether or not this feeling is due to sin (Psalm 25:2-3; Proverbs 19:26; Romans 1:16).
